Window tint should in no way effect the warranty whether it is installed at port or aftermarket. Most reputable shops with a quality brand tint will come with a lifetime warranty against bubbles and fading, so if the tint you are getting only lasts the manufactures warranty you may be not getting as good of a deal as aftermarket.
